Poisson Distribution

A statistical probability distribution that expresses the probability of a given number of events occurring in a fixed interval of time or space when these events occur with a known constant mean rate and independently of the time since the last event.

Negative Exponential Distribution

A probability distribution used to model time between independent events that occur at a constant average rate.
